A man accused of killing a Westport jewelry store owner in December has committed suicide in prison, according to officials.
Andrew Robert Levene, also known as Robert Thomas, 41, was arrested after he fled the United States and was arrested in Spain on Monday.
Westport police said Levene killed the owner of YZ Manufacturers, LLC, Yekutiel Zeevi, on the Boston Post Road on Dec. 8. and seriously inured his associate.
Police said they believe that Levene pretended he was going to complete the purchase of several large diamonds that had arranged to buy earlier that month when shot and killed store owner and wounded the associate.
He is suspected of also stealing $300,000 in diamonds before fleeing the United States for Europe.
